No. 20 Men's Tennis Ready for ITA Kickoff Weekend

No. 20 Men's Tennis Ready for ITA Kickoff WeekendNo. 20 Men's Tennis Ready for ITA Kickoff Weekend
LEXINGTON – No. 20 Sun Devil Men's Tennis will travel to Lexington Kentucky for the 2025 ITA Kickoff Weekend hosted by No. 12 Kentucky. Arizona State will play Nebraska on Friday, January 24 at 3 p.m. MST. On Saturday, the Sun Devils will matchup against either No. 12 Kentucky or Santa Clara, with times dependent on the result against Nebraska. The Championship Match will take place at 2 p.m. MST, while the Consolation Match will start at 10 a.m. MST. 

Wins in both matches this weekend would send the team to Dallas for the ITA Indoor National Championship February 14-18 to compete against the 15 other teams that emerged victorious in their Kickoff Weekend brackets.

SUN DEVIL NOTABLES (2-1)
  • Last season the Sun Devils advanced to the National Indoor Championship in Manhattan after defeating No. 25 Florida State and VCU in the Starkville Regional hosted by Mississippi State. 
  • No. 2 seed of the Lexington Regional
  • The duo of Daniel Phillips and Tanner Povey is 3-0 in doubles matches this season. 
  • ASU has earned the doubles point in all three matches this season.
  • Graduate transfer Matic Dimic has clinched both matches for ASU. 
  • Senior transfer Mathis Bondaz played in his first match for the Sun Devils against No. 1 Texas. He was the lone singles match to go into three sets, though he eventually fell from the second position. 
  • ASU checked in at No. 20 in the Week One ITA Polls.
PREVIEWING THE CORN HUSKERS (2-0)
  • Nebraska has picked up two 7-0 victories to open the season undefeated. 
  • The Corn Huskers participated in the Kentucky-hosted Kickoff weekend last season, and fell in their first match against Alabama, but won the consolation match against Notre Dame.  
  • Nebraska has not played on the road this season, and will get their first taste of playing on unfamiliar courts this weekend. 
  • No. 3 seed of the Lexington Regional
PREVIEWING THE WILDCATS (2-1)
  • Checked in the Week one ITA Polls at No. 12.
  • Opened the season ranked No. 7, and after winning their first two matches of the season, the Wildcats fell 5-2 to No. 23 Michigan State. 
  • The last matchup between ASU and Kentucky was back in 1991. The two teams have not met since the program's reinstatement in 2018. ASU came out on top 5-2.
  • Has two players ranked in the ITA Singles Top-100: Jaden Weekes (39) and Charlelie Cosnet (79).
PREVIEWING THE BRONCOS (1-1)
  • Santa Clara enters their first-round match against Kentucky at 1-1 on the 2025 season, defeating Sacramento State in their season opener before being swept by Oregon in a match in Eugene. 
  • No. 4 seed of the Lexington Regional
  • The Broncos are coming off a successful 2024 season in which they recorded the most team wins since 2012.
  • Peaked at No. 53 in the ITA rankings last season. 
  • Saw Head Coach Niall Angus win the Wilson/ITA Northwest Region Coach of the Year Award. 
  • SCU earned a bid to the UTR Sports NIT Championship last season, defeating Northwestern before falling to eventual champion Tulsa.
